Incentives, search and structure
We intend to investigate if incentives shape search behavior throughout 50 rounds of the Alien Game. Prior studies have failed to show a relation between distant search behavior and incentives, but these studies were carried out in an unstructured task environment, that inhibited learning about the underlying task structure. In this version we present participants with a structured task environment, that in theory enables learning. Based on this setup we can compare search behavior in a structured and unstructured (NK) task environment.
